Ingredients


– 1 box pistachio pudding mix (3.4 ounces)
– 1 cup granulated sugar
– 1 cup vegetable oil
– 4 large eggs
– 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
– 2 cups all-purpose flour
– 1 teaspoon baking soda
– ½ teaspoon salt
– 1 cup sour cream
– 1 cup chopped walnuts (optional)
– Powdered sugar, for dusting

Step-by-Step Instructions


Creating Watergate Bundt Cake is simple if you follow these easy steps:
1.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our a Bundt pan thoroughly to prevent sticking.
2. Mix Wet 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, combine the pistachio pudding mix, granulated sugar, vegetable oil, eggs, and vanilla extract. Mix until well blended.
3. Combine Dry Ingredients: In another b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king soda, and salt.
4. Add Dry to Wet: Gradually fold the dry mixture into the wet ingredients until just combined.
5. Incorporate Sour Cream: Gently mix in the sour cream until the batter is smooth and consistent.
6. Add Nuts: If using, fold in the chopped walnuts for added texture and flavor.
7. Pour into Pan: Carefully pour the batter into the prepared Bundt pan, smoothing the top with a spatula.
8. Bake: Bake in the preheated oven for 35-40 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
9. Cool the Cake: Once baked, remove from the oven and allow to cool in the pan for about 15-20 minutes. Then, turn it out onto a wire rack to cool completely.
10. Dust with Powdered Sugar: Once cool, dust the top with powdered sugar for a beautiful finish.

Additional Tips


– Use Quality Ingredients: For exceptional flavor, use high-quality pistachio pudding mix and fresh eggs.
– Measure Accurately: Proper measurement of flour and sugar ensures consistent results in texture and sweetness.
– Don’t Rush Cooling: Allow the cake to cool thoroughly to prevent it from breaking when you remove it from the pan.
– Experiment with Toppings: While it’s delightful on its own, consider toppings like chocolate ganache, whipped cream, or chopped pistachios for added flair.
– Serve at Room Temperature: Allow the cake to sit out for a bit before serving. This enhances its flavors and texture.

Recipe Variation


Feel free to mix and match! Here are a few variations to try out:
1. Gluten-Free Option: Replace all-purpose flour with a 1:1 gluten-free flour blend for a gluten-free version.
2. Dairy-Free Version: Substitute sour cream with a dairy-free yogurt or sour cream alternative for a dairy-free treat.
3. Creative Add-ins: Add in some crushed pineapple for a tropical twist or mini chocolate chips for a touch of sweetness.
4. Holiday-Themed: For festive occasions, you can replace pistachio pudding with a peppermint flavor during winter holidays.

Freezing and Storage


Storage: Keep the cake covered at room temperature for up to 3 days or in the refrigerator to prolong its freshness.
Freezing: For longer storage, you can freeze your Watergate Bundt Cake for up to 3 months. Make sure to wrap it tightly in plastic wrap and aluminum foil to prevent freezer burn.

Frequently Asked Questions


How can I tell when the cake is done?
Insert a toothpick into the center of the cake; if it comes out clean, your cake is done baking.
Can I make this cake in advance?
Absolutely! Making it a day ahead allows the flavors to meld beautifully.
Is the Watergate Bundt Cake suitable for those with allergies?
You can adapt the recipe by using nut-free options for the walnuts and gluten-free flour for a gluten-free treat.
What can I do if I don’t like pistachios?
You can substitute the pistachio pudding mix with vanilla pudding mix for a different flavor profile.
How should I store leftovers?
Store leftovers in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days or refrigerate for extended freshness.
